Kwan skips practice session

|
|
 
  
Published: Feb. 11, 2006 at 9:28 AM

TURIN, Italy, Feb. 11 (UPI) -- Michelle Kwan skipped her Olympic practice session Saturday and expressed concern that she would be fit enough to compete in next week's figure skating event.

Kwan, a five-time world champion but never an Olympic gold medalist, chose not to go through her routine and merely skated around the practice ice in an attempt to loosen up.

"I got on the ice and I was a little stiff," Kwan said. "I just wanted to get out and get my legs under me and test the ice."

Kwan was unable to compete in the American Olympic trials last month because of a groin injury, but was given a spot on the team after she successfully skated for a panel of judges.

"Dropping out, it's not something I want to do, but I have to listen to how my feelings are," she said.

If Kwan cannot compete, her spot on the team would be taken by Emily Hughes. When asked on Saturday what advice she would give Hughes, Kwan said:

"Be prepared."
